Some of the terms may be confusing. So, you will find a quick reference below:
Account: means collectively the personal information, payment information and credentials used to access content on the website.
Content: means any text, graphics, images, audio, video, and any other form of information provided to you.
Cookie: means a small text file placed on your computer when you visit our website or webpages. This allows us to identify recurring visitors and to analyse their browsing habits within the website or webpage.
Data: means all information relating to an identified or identifiable living natural person that you submit to the website.
Service: means courses, products, consulting or advice you are offered.
Controller: means the natural or legal person, public authority, agency, or any other body which, alone or jointly with others, decides the purposes and means of the processing of personal data.
Third Party: means a natural or legal person, public authority, agency, or any other body other than the data subject, the controller, the processor, and persons who, under the authority of the controller or processor, are authorized to process personal data.
